We have an opportunity for a Production Technician to join our Burr Ridge, IL team. You will be responsible for assembling, testing, and preparing specialized valve insertion and line stopping equipment used in water and wastewater infrastructure. This role involves hands-on manufacturing, maintaining high quality standards, and ensuring safety in a fast-paced environment.

You will:

  • Assemble, test, and package Hydra-Stop's proprietary products, including valve insertion and line stopping tools.
  • Perform rigorous inspection of parts and assemblies to ensure they meet engineering specifications before shipping.
  • Perform preventative maintenance on shop equipment and troubleshoot production bottlenecks.
  • Adhere to all safety regulations, including wearing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) and maintaining a clean work area.
  • Maintain accurate records for production logs, material tracking, and quality reports.
  • Work with engineering and team leads to improve manufacturing efficiency.

Key Qualifications:

  • 6 months of recent manufacturing experience
  • Understand safety regulations including OSHA standards and adhere to them
  • Proficiency in mechanical work and tool usage such as wrenches and other hand tools.
  • Standing, walking, twisting at the waist, lifting, and lowering weights up to 40lbs
  • Steel toed shoes are required on the distribution floor.
  • Attention to detail
  • Teamwork environment
